Arizona Treefrog vs Japanese Treefrog

Dryophytes wrightorum compared with Dryophytes japonicus

Taxonomic Classification

Rank Arizona Treefrog Japanese Treefrog
Kingdom same Animalia (Tier) Animalia (Tier)
Phylum same Chordata (Chordatiere) Chordata (Chordatiere)
Class same Amphibia (Amphibien) Amphibia (Amphibien)
Order same Anura (Froschlurche) Anura (Froschlurche)
Family same Hylidae Hylidae
Genus same Dryophytes Dryophytes
Species Dryophytes wrightorum Dryophytes japonicus

Evolutionary Relationship

Arizona Treefrog and Japanese Treefrog share a common ancestor at the Genus level: Dryophytes.
